Is support and ADC the same?

Supports have so many options to decide the game state. They don’t need to rely on a successful lane to gain a big advantage on the other team. ADCs, on the other hand, need to rely on strong play from both the support and the jungler in order to find ways to efficiently succeed, no matter how good you are.

Who counters jinx ADC?

League of Legends Wild Rift Jinx Counters are Tristana, Draven, and Corki, which have the best chance of winning Jinx in the lane. You DO NOT want to pick Ezreal or Lucian as they will most likely lose to Jinx. In Terms of Synergy, picks like Leona and Blitzcrank are good with Jinx.

What is an ADC in League of Legends?

Typically, the ADC does a sizeable amount of damage to all on the enemy team, with the exception of potentially the Tank. The trade-off though, comes with an ADC’s relatively low base health and defence, meaning they are known to be “squishy” (die easily), but this is usually compensated by a Support champion.

What is an AD Carry in League of Legends?

The “AD Carry” champions attack from a distance. Their ultimate goal is to be able to eliminate enemies with ease and to be one of the champions is to do more damage in the game. Some good champions for this role are Miss Fortune, Vayne, Sivir, Caitlyn, or Tristana thanks to their skills and performance.
